## Artifact signing for plugin authors

All Dateglass locale plugins must ship signed. Plugins supply format patterns per locale; unsigned bundles are rejected at install. Keep pattern files ASCII-safe and validate against the Calverton schema before packaging. Sign the final archive, not individual files. Verify your build locally against the registry. The signing key for the plugin registry is the following.

signing key of bagap-yawep = bky13_TbfT6ZMUoGJo2

Applies to the Kestrel Hall facility, Dromley Park campus. Visitors going to Cage C7 must sign the escort log at reception and surrender photo ID until exit. No bags beyond the mantrap. Escorts must be Hollivant Systems staff on the approved list posted behind the desk. Deliveries for the cage go through the loading dock, never the lobby. Tours are not permitted without prior clearance from the Facilities lead. If the escort is delayed more than fifteen minutes, call the NOC. For after-hours cage access, issue the temporary pass below.

door code, bawif-hawef: bdg-HMTCP-8

TURN-208: Gatevale turnstile counters at the Merrow Field pilot double-count when a rotation reverses mid-cycle. Attendance totals drift roughly 2% high per event. The debounce window fix is implemented, reviewed by Ilsa, and soak-tested across two simulated match days without drift. Ready for your cut; the candidate build is identified below.

trace token, tagag-tafog: htk6_5ed18c

## Release Notes Process — LadleMath Calculator

LadleMath ships biweekly. Scaling-engine changes require sign-off from the conversions team before cut; rounding-rule changes require a migration note. Version tags follow the usual scheme; hotfixes branch from the last release tag only. Do not cut a release while the unit-conversion regression suite is red. Checklist, sign-off owners, and rollback steps for the release manager are maintained on the internal page linked below.

dashboard of kadup-bafop = https://kibana.merlaqcorp.internal/settings